Assistant Horticulturist (Landscape and Machinery)

Salary: £23,487-£27,116 per annum
The role holder supports the Garden Landscapes team on the maintenance of the hard landscape areas of the Garden including paths, maintains turf areas and composting areas, hedges throughout the Garden and provides servicing and repair of equipment and staff training in the safe use of machinery. The collections and areas within this role are popular with visitors and are an important resource for research and education purposes within the Garden, University and the wider botanical and horticultural community.
Reporting to the Team Leader (Garden Landscapes) the role holder will be responsible for caring for specific areas of the Garden and its collections.

Assistant Horticulturist (Trees and Shrubs)

Salary: £23,487-£27,116 per annum
The role holder supports the Garden Landscapes team on the maintenance, care and curation of the trees and other wood collections. The tree collection is one of the finest in the East of England, of great heritage value and of international significance. The role includes the care and maintenance of associated herbaceous plantings and turf areas. There is also a requirement for occasional arboricultural work.
Excellent plantsmanship is required in this role to ensure that the collections are developed and maintained. The collections and areas within this role are popular with visitors and are an important resource for research and education purposes within the Garden, University and the wider botanical and horticultural community.

Collections Coordinator

Salary: £27,116 – £31,406 per annum
This is a new post at the Cambridge University Botanic Garden (CUBG).
The collections at Cambridge University Botanic Garden are at the heart of our identity, helping to drive the University’s pursuit of excellence in education, learning and research.The post holder will play a key part in integrating and coordinating our collections with each other, with the University, and with external stakeholders.
The post holder will support curation of the collections with a focus on coordinating the management and utilisation of the different collections: living, herbarium, seed, and archives. The post holder will accelerate the integration and management of our herbarium and living collections, seed collection and seed bank development, and the acquisition of high-quality material through botanical expeditions and plant collecting.
We are looking for an enthusiastic, energetic and team-oriented individual who is experienced and knowledgeable about plants, plant science, plant conservation, and collections. A keen and active interest in plant taxonomy and systematics, evidenced by graduate and/or post-qualifications is highly desirable.
